Getting There

  • Public Bus

    From the main bus terminal in David, look for buses heading towards Volcán. Buses frequently depart, so you should not have to wait long. The journey takes about 30-40 minutes. Inform the driver that you want to get off at Vía Caizán, Km 6, Barriles. Once you arrive, you may need to walk a bit; ask locals for directions to Sitio Barriles, which is a short walk from the bus stop.

  • Taxi/Shared Taxi

    You can take a taxi or a shared taxi (known as a 'colectivo') from David to Sitio Barriles. To find a taxi, you can either hail one on the street or go to a designated taxi stand. If you opt for a shared taxi, head to the area near the main bus terminal where they congregate. The ride will take approximately 30 minutes. Make sure to mention 'Sitio Barriles' to the driver or show them the address: Vía Caizán, Km 6, Barriles. This is a convenient option if you prefer a more direct route.

  • Walking (if in nearby area)

    If you find yourself in the vicinity of Barriles, you can walk to Sitio Barriles. Start on Vía Caizán and head towards Km 6. Look for signs pointing towards the archaeological site or ask locals for further guidance. The walk may take some time depending on your exact starting point, so plan accordingly.

Discover more about Sitio Barriles

Situated in the lush landscapes of Chiriquí Province, Sitio Barriles is an archaeological treasure that offers visitors a glimpse into the pre-Columbian era. This fascinating tourist attraction features a variety of ancient artifacts and a well-preserved site that speaks to the region's rich historical tapestry. As you wander through the area, you’ll encounter a series of well-marked trails that guide you through the remnants of ancient civilizations, providing insights into their daily lives, cultures, and practices. The artifacts found at Sitio Barriles highlight the craftsmanship and ingenuity of the indigenous peoples who once inhabited this region. Among the displays, you'll find pottery, tools, and ceremonial items that depict a time long past. The serene surroundings enhance the experience, allowing you to appreciate not only the historical significance of the site but also the natural beauty of the area. The site is open daily from 8 AM to 4 PM, making it accessible for both early risers and late afternoon explorers. In addition to the archaeological elements, Sitio Barriles is enveloped in the vibrant flora and fauna of the region, making it an ideal location for nature enthusiasts.
